2.   He صَلَّى الـلّٰـهُ عَلَيْهِ وَاٰلِهٖ وَسَلَّم stated: خَیْرُکُم خَیْرُکُم لِاَہْلِہٖ وَاَنا خَیْرُکُم لِاَہْلِی – “The best amongst you is the one who is good to his family, and I am the best towards my family from among you.”[2]

3.   He صَلَّى الـلّٰـهُ عَلَيْهِ وَاٰلِهٖ وَسَلَّم also said, “A believing man should not consider his believing wife to be an enemy. If he is displeased with one of her habits, he will be pleased with another of her habits.”[3]

Mufti Ahmad Yar Khan رَحْمَةُ الـلّٰـهِ عَلَيْه comments in relation to this hadith:  سُـبْحٰـنَ الـلّٰــه! This is an excellent lesson. The purport is that it is impossible to find a faultless wife. Therefore, if there are some things you dislike about her, be patient, for she will have some good qualities too. The author of Mirqat رَحْمَةُ الـلّٰـهِ عَلَيْه states: The person who searches for a faultless partner will live alone in this world. We are full of many shortcomings ourselves. Overlook the faults of your friends and relatives, focus on the good. Yes, do attempt to rectify them; only the Messenger of Allah صَلَّى الـلّٰـهُ عَلَيْهِ وَاٰلِهٖ وَسَلَّم is faultless.[4]
